Finally, the archetype forces us to confront a dark theological question: can evil evolve, or does it simply relocate? In literature, from the cursed kings of antiquity to the modern anti-heroes of prestige television, the reborn demon father often meets a tragic end. He does not die because he is weak, but because he is incomplete. He possesses the memories of a monster and the aspirations of a man, and these two halves tear him apart. The most poignant version of this story is not one of triumphant redemption, but of tragic repetition. Despite his best efforts, the demon father commits the same sin in a different key. He tries to protect and instead imprisons. He tries to nurture and instead neglects. His rebirth is a loop, not a line.
Unlike the typical "I was a loser in my past life" Isekai protagonist, the Demon Father is usually overpowered (OP). He has centuries of combat experience, magical knowledge, and political savvy. We aren't watching him struggle to learn how to hold a sword; we are watching him struggle to hold back his strength so he doesn't accidentally destroy the village while protecting his kid. It’s satisfying to see a protagonist who is actually good at things.
